Press Release Body: San Antonio, TX: September 29, 2008 - On September 12, two
Pitching Pads found a new home at the St. Louis Cardinals minor league complex in
Jupiter, Florida. The Pitching Pads are located at Roger Dean Stadium for the fall
instructional league.

Minor League pitching coordinator Brent Strom wanted to make sure that the Cardinals
have all the available tools to improve their performance.

"With the minor leagues being a time to hone skills that are required to pitch at
the Major League level it is imperative that control be developed, not only in ones
ability to throw strikes but to throw quality strikes," says Strom. "There is a
difference between control and command, and The Pitching Pad allows pitchers to
practice both, on their own without the often times problem of finding a catcher."

The Pitching Pad is a baseball and softball training tool that allows players to
work on their accuracy and control by utilizing a high quality strike zone target.
The Pad gives players the freedom to practice whenever they want as much as they
want without needing another player to play catch with.

Strom added, "Without question, if the Cardinal pitchers utilize this unique product
and all the variations one can imagine in beating the hitter with improved location
and pitch sequencing, then, when they are in a major league stadium looking to hit a
spot and succeed in doing so, there is no doubt in my mind that some of the credit
should go to "THE PAD"."

The Pitching Pad was created and is produced by Bishop Family Enterprises based in
San Antonio, Texas. Bishop Family Enterprises is committed to helping baseball and
softball players improve their skills and abilities through high quality training
products.
